ВУЗ: Не указан
Категория: Не указан
Дисциплина: Не указана
Добавлен: 16.12.2020
Просмотров: 1075
Скачиваний: 1
212
состоялись
(
он
улетел
на
собственном
самолете
на
отдых
,
а
его
кол
-
леги
были
напуганы
категорическим
требованием
IBM
сохранять
разработку
в
строжайшей
тайне
),
тогда
«
голубой
гигант
»
обратился
к
начинающей
фирме
Microsoft,
известной
своим
интерпретатором
Бэйсика
для
Altair.
Быстро
соориентировавшись
в
обстановке
,
мо
-
лодые
предприниматели
купили
за
50 000
долларов
у
Тима
Паттер
-
сона
(Tim Patterson)
из
фирмы
Seattle Computer Products
операци
-
онную
систему
Q-DOS (Quick and Dirty —
быстрая
и
грязная
),
адап
-
тировали
ее
и
выпустили
в
том
же
1981
году
под
фирменным
назва
-
нием
MS-DOS — Microsoft Disk Operating System.
Этот
заказ
имел
для
Билла
Гейтса
и
Пола
Аллена
эпохальные
пследствия
,
он
поло
-
жил
начало
многолетнему
сотрудничеству
с
IBM
и
взлету
Microsoft.
MS-DOS
ожидала
удивительная
судьба
,
вместе
с
компьютерами
IBM PC
она
живет
уже
почти
20
лет
.
На
ней
выросло
не
одно
поко
-
ление
программистов
,
даже
сейчас
,
в
начале
нового
века
,
знание
этой
классической
истемы
считается
необходимиым
для
системно
-
го
программиста
.
Система
проста
и
надежна
,
требует
минимум
ре
-
сурсов
,
работает
на
самых
слабых
процессорах
.
Вместе
с
тем
она
имеет
ряд
принципиальных
недостатков
:
нет
встроенных
средств
управления
расширенной
памятью
и
внешними
устройствами
,
от
-
сутствует
графический
интерфейс
с
пользователем
.
Каждый
про
-
граммист
вынужден
решать
эти
задачи
по
-
своему
,
что
сильно
ус
-
ложняет
процесс
проектирования
,
установки
и
сопровождения
при
-
кладных
программ
.
Общение
пользователя
с
системой
MS-DOS
происходит
на
«
пти
-
чьем
»
языке
,
требующем
знания
точного
синтаксиса
нескольких
десятков
команд
.
Для
того
,
чтобы
создать
или
скопировать
файл
средствами
самой
системы
,
нужно
написать
в
командной
строке
не
-
сколько
строк
неудобоваримого
текста
.
Для
облегчения
этой
рабо
-
ты
независимыми
производителями
были
созданы
командно
-
фай
-
ловые
оболочки
,
позволяющие
простейшие
операции
с
файлами
про
-
изводить
с
помощью
клавиш
управления
курсором
.
Самая
извест
-
ная
из
них
— Norton Commander,
разработанная
легендарным
про
-
граммистом
эпохи
DOS
Питером
Нортоном
(Norton, Peter).
На
лю
-
бом
снимке
тех
лет
с
экрана
IBM PC
хорощо
видны
две
голубые
213
панели
этой
исключительно
простой
и
удобной
программы
.
Даже
после
появления
Windows
профессиональные
программисты
пред
-
почитали
работать
с
файлами
не
стандартными
средствами
,
а
ста
-
рой
и
доброй
оболочкой
Norton
или
ее
преемником
—
системой
Far.
Созданная
Нортоном
фирма
Symantec
очень
популярна
в
компь
-
ютерном
мире
благодаря
многочисленным
вспомогательным
про
-
граммам
—
утилитам
,
выполняющим
,
по
меткому
выражению
не
-
которых
экспертов
,
функции
«
огнетушителя
,
бронежилета
и
спаса
-
тельного
круга
для
персональных
компьютеов
».
Недаром
личный
автомобиль
Питера
Нортона
имеет
уникальный
номерной
знак
«Mr IBM PC».
Mac-OS
и
NeXTSTEP
.
В
предыдущей
главе
мы
уже
рассматри
-
вали
историю
появления
графического
пользовательского
интерфей
-
са
.
Напомним
,
что
первой
массовой
операционной
системой
,
в
ко
-
торой
он
был
реализован
,
была
Mac-OS,
разработанная
в
1984
году
фирмой
Apple
для
своих
«
Макинтошей
»,
и
основанная
на
идейном
багаже
,
накопленном
за
многие
годы
центром
Xerox PARC.
Во
мно
-
гом
благодаря
этой
операционной
системе
«
Маки
»
в
80-
е
годы
от
-
воевали
значительную
долю
рынка
персональных
компьютеров
.
Новый
решительный
шаг
в
развитиии
настольных
ОС
был
сде
-
лан
лидером
Apple
Стивом
Джобсом
после
его
неожиданного
ухода
из
компании
в
1985
году
и
организации
фирмы
NeXT Inc.
Опера
-
ционная
система
NeXTSTEP,
выпущенная
в
1987
году
для
компью
-
тера
NeXT,
была
построена
совершенно
по
-
новому
,
с
использова
-
нием
самых
передовых
идей
объектно
-
ориентированного
програм
-
мирования
.
Однако
этот
революционный
проект
не
имел
коммер
-
ческого
успеха
,
в
1996
году
фирма
NeXT Inc.
была
куплена
Apple
Computer
за
425
миллионов
долларов
,
а
Стив
Джобс
вернулся
в
род
-
ные
пенаты
,
где
реализует
идеи
NeXTSTEP
в
новых
версиях
Mac-
OS.
Ранние
версии
Windows
.
На
фоне
графической
Mac-OS MS-
DOS
сразу
стала
выглядеть
старомодно
.
Первый
шаг
Microsoft —
попытка
просто
купить
систему
у
Apple,
но
когда
последняя
отказа
-
лась
от
сделки
,
Биллу
Гейтсу
пришлось
заняться
созданием
соб
-
214
ственной
графической
операционной
системы
для
клона
IBM PC.
Не
решаясь
разрабатывать
совершенно
новую
ОС
, Microsoft
на
пер
-
вых
порах
ограничилась
полумерами
.
В
1985
году
вышла
графичес
-
кая
оболочка
Windows 1.0,
которая
запускалась
под
MS-DOS
как
обычная
резидентная
программа
и
брала
на
себя
функции
управле
-
ния
окнами
и
организации
диалога
с
пользователем
.
Однако
эта
обо
-
лочка
была
очень
неповоротливой
,
на
286-
х
процессорах
она
рабо
-
тала
с
большим
замедлением
.
Версия
2.0
тоже
не
пользовалась
ус
-
пехом
,
программисты
не
желали
переписывать
приложения
DOS
под
оконный
интерфейс
.
Однако
Microsoft
продолжала
настйчиво
дора
-
батывать
и
рекламировать
систему
,
с
третьей
попытки
лед
недове
-
рия
пользователей
тронулся
,
фирма
постепенно
стала
завоевывать
авторитет
на
рынке
графических
операционных
систем
,
однако
это
произошло
уже
в
90-
х
годах
1
.
OS/2
против
Windows
.
Первая
половина
90-
х
годов
отмечена
ожесточенным
противостоянием
между
двумя
недавними
партне
-
рами
— IBM
и
Microsoft
на
рынке
операционных
систем
.
Выйдя
в
1987
году
на
рынок
персональных
компьютеров
с
но
-
вой
серией
PS/2, IBM
решила
удивить
мир
не
только
аппаратурой
,
но
и
очередным
программным
суперпроектом
.
Вместе
с
машинами
готовилась
к
выпуску
принципиально
новая
32-
разрядная
опера
-
ционная
система
OS/2 — Operating System/2,
которая
должна
была
заменить
DOS
и
превзойти
все
известные
системы
,
реализовав
гра
-
фический
интерфейс
,
многозадачность
,
возможность
работы
в
сети
.
Для
того
,
чтобы
объединть
большой
опыт
IBM
в
области
разработ
-
ки
ОС
для
мэйнфреймов
с
удачными
продуктами
Microsoft,
в
рам
-
ках
стратегического
партнерства
двух
фирм
была
создана
объеди
-
ненная
команда
разработчиков
,
которая
приступила
к
реализации
этого
замысла
.
Первые
версии
OS/2
были
выпущены
в
1987-1990
годах
,
но
они
не
имели
полноценного
графического
интерфейса
и
1
Фирма
Apple
была
крайне
недовольна
тем
,
что
Microsoft
использовала
детали
ин
-
терфейса
MacOS
в
системе
Windows
и
даже
подала
на
нее
в
суд
.
Этот
процесс
Apple
проиграла
,
и
произошло
это
потому
,
что
ранее
суд
оказался
на
ее
стороне
в
споре
с
Xerox,
предъявившей
аналогичные
претензии
.
Если
бы
суд
решил
по
-
друго
-
му
,
история
ОС
могла
бы
пойти
иным
путем
.
215
не
оказали
существенного
влияния
на
рынок
.
Потом
работы
замед
-
лились
,
потому
что
Microsoft,
у
которой
стали
налаживаться
дела
с
Windows,
не
проявляла
особого
рвения
в
разработке
OS/2.
Отноше
-
ния
между
партнерами
стали
накаляться
,
дело
кончилось
полным
разрывом
.
Стороны
договорились
о
том
,
что
текущая
версия
систе
-
мы
принадлежит
им
в
равной
мере
,
дальнейшую
работу
над
ее
со
-
вершенствованием
они
будут
вести
самостоятельно
и
независимо
друг
от
друга
.
Прекратив
отношения
с
IBM, Microsoft
постаралась
выжать
все
из
Windows.
Версия
3.0,
появившаяся
в
1990
году
,
стала
пользо
-
ваться
популярностью
,
начался
массовый
перевод
приложений
под
эту
операционную
систему
,
тем
более
,
что
к
этому
времени
подо
-
спели
386-
е
процессоры
,
вполне
удовлетворяющие
аппетиты
этой
прожорливой
ОС
.
Вместе
с
Windows
росли
популярность
и
богат
-
ство
самой
Microsoft,
из
второразрядной
фирмы
она
превратилась
в
могущественную
и
влиятельную
корпорацию
в
компьютерном
мире
,
бросившую
вызов
самой
IBM.
Феноменальный
успех
версии
3.1 (
в
апреле
1992
года
за
первые
50
дней
было
продано
свыше
миллиона
копий
)
настроил
компанию
на
весьма
агрессивное
рыночное
пове
-
дение
.
Миллионы
долларов
тратились
на
рекламу
,
писались
заказ
-
ные
статьи
в
пользу
Windows,
что
в
конце
концов
приводило
к
ус
-
пеху
—
все
новые
команды
разработчиков
проектировали
свои
при
-
ложения
с
расчетом
на
эту
операционную
систему
.
На
этом
фоне
действия
IBM
выглядели
вялыми
.
Графический
компонент
OS/2
появился
только
в
1992
году
в
версии
2.0,
система
явно
отставала
от
Windows.
Хотя
развитие
OS/2
продолжалось
—
в
1994
и
1996
годах
вышли
новые
версии
3 (Warp)
и
4 (Merlin),
и
технические
свойства
системы
постоянно
улучшались
,
завоевать
ры
-
нок
настольных
систем
OS/2
не
сумела
.
Все
хвалили
ее
за
надеж
-
ность
,
экономность
к
ресурсам
,
но
...
покупали
Windows,
потому
что
рынок
пакетов
прикладных
программ
был
уже
сориентирован
на
эту
систему
.
В
1995
году
Microsoft,
выдержав
драматическую
паузу
и
сопро
-
водив
этот
акт
небывалой
рекламной
шумихой
,
выпустила
на
ры
-
нок
32-
разрядную
Windows-95 (
кодовое
имя
Chicago),
предназна
-
216
ченную
для
замены
Windows 3.1.
По
своим
техническим
возможно
-
стям
она
не
представляла
собой
ничего
выдающегося
,
по
крайней
мере
,
по
сравнению
с
OS/2,
но
зато
с
точки
зрения
дизайна
это
был
шедевр
.
Цвета
окон
,
форма
и
размеры
значков
,
структура
меню
—
все
было
сделано
с
большим
вкусом
и
умением
.
Система
явно
была
рассчитана
на
массового
потребителя
,
имела
множество
мелких
удобств
—
от
автоматической
конфигурации
внешних
устройств
(plug-and-play)
до
набора
игр
.
Рабочий
стол
Windows-95
стал
клас
-
сическим
для
второй
половины
90-
х
годов
.
Windows-95 (
в
1998
году
вышел
ее
обновленный
вариант
Windows-98)
окончательно
вытеснила
OS/2
с
рынка
массовых
на
-
стольных
ОС
для
платформы
Intel,
однако
остался
еще
один
сектор
применения
,
где
позиции
OS/2
пока
еще
оставались
сильными
.
Речь
идет
о
корпоративных
профессиональных
пользователях
,
для
кото
-
рых
исключительно
важна
производительность
,
стабильность
и
бе
-
зопасность
ОС
—
те
качества
,
по
которым
продукция
Microsoft
подвергалась
резкой
критике
со
стороны
компьютерной
обществен
-
ности
.
Однако
Microsoft
не
собиралась
уступать
конкурентам
высо
-
кодоходный
корпоративный
рынок
и
бросила
в
битву
с
ними
свой
стратегический
резерв
—
операционную
систему
Windows NT.
Windows NT
.
Получив
в
результате
развода
с
IBM
еще
несовер
-
шенную
,
но
безусловно
перспективную
OS/2, Microsoft
доработала
ее
в
соответствии
со
своими
взглядами
и
выпустила
в
1993
году
в
продажу
под
наименованием
Windows NT 3.1.
У
покупателя
оно
сразу
вызывало
ассоциации
с
популярной
в
то
время
Windows 3.1,
а
две
дополнительные
буквы
,
казалось
,
намекали
на
то
,
что
новая
система
—
ее
некоторая
разновидность
.
На
самом
деле
это
совсем
не
так
. «
За
спиной
»
у
Windows
в
фирме
началась
разработка
прин
-
ципиально
нового
поколения
операционых
систем
(
сокращение
NT
означает
New Technology).
В
отличие
от
«
ширпотребовской
»
Windows, Windows NT
изначально
создавалась
в
расчете
на
исполь
-
зование
в
корпоративных
вычислительных
сетях
.
Она
значительно
более
производительна
,
стабильна
и
безопасна
,
однако
платой
за
это
являются
высокие
требования
к
оперативной
памяти
и
большая
стоимость
.
Система
поставлялась
в
двух
вариантах
: Windows NT